The Best Free Computer Games

Who says you need to pay an arm and a leg for good computer games? Want to run around with an M16 and lay waste to people? No problem. How about go adventuring in a dungeon? No worries. Maybe you just want to take over the world? Again, not an issue.

This collection of the best free computer games on the web contains a little something for everyone from the RPG nut to the strategy game enthusiast to those who just want to go out and blast something. These are free full game downloads, some of which were commercial games that have since been released as freeware. This list excludes Flash and other web-based games, so each of these games will require you to download the game and install it on your computer.

Dark Queen of Samobor - Official Trailer

Dark Queen of Samobor is a 2.5D narrative action-adventure inspired by Croatian and Slavic mythology. Step into the pages of a cursed fairytale as a hero knight and battle through various haunting biomes, twisted creatures, and ancient horrors to reach the Dark Queen’s castle.

Featuring handcrafted visuals, epic boss fights, and a fully directed camera – this is a dark fairytale brought to life.

Coming 2026.

Ninja Gaiden: Ragebound - Release Date Announcement

From the acclaimed team behind Blasphemous, NINJA GAIDEN: Ragebound successfully unites the classic lore and gameplay of the Tecmo-developed (now KOEI TECMO GAMES) NINJA GAIDEN series from the classic era with the depth and intensity of the modern 3D entries. The best of both eras come together to create an epic and thrilling adventure.
